Montreal Canadiens News & Notes:

The Canadiens picked up their second straight win as they beat the Red Wings last night. The Canadiens improved to 5-0 when Patrik Laine scores a goal.

Detroit Red Wings News & Notes:

The Red Wings saw their two game winning streak snapped last night as they squandered away a third period lead giving up two goals.

Players To Watch:

Montreal Canadiens

Patrik Laine this season since his return has recorded eight points on seven goals and eight assists. He’s faced Detroit 21 times in his career recording 19 points on 11 goals and eight assists; he scored the game winner last night.

Detroit Red Wings

Patrick Kane this season has 14 points on five goals and nine assists. He’s faced Montreal 25 times in his career recording 22 points on ten goals and 12 assists; he scored a goal in last night’s loss.
